The largest -backed militia in , Kataib , unexpectedly said it will cease its attacks on the U.S. military in retaliation for the war in Gaza out of respect to the Iraqi government.

The suspension of military and security operation -- three days after three U.S. troops were killed in a drone strike that Washington says Kataib Hezbollah likely carried out -- was to avoid "embarrassing" the government in Baghdad
